Current office and 2026 campaign

Tanner Jones is the Republican nominee for Blount County Commission District 3, Seat A, unopposed on the Aug. 6, 2026 general-election ballot 12. He won a three-way Republican primary on May 5, 2026 with 767 of 1,255 votes cast, defeating incumbent Scott King and challenger Stefan Wilson 23. At 25, the Daily Times reported he is potentially the youngest commissioner ever elected to the board; Jones said, "There's several of us younger guys that won Tuesday" 3.

Background and education

Jones describes himself as an 11th-generation Blount Countian and lifelong District 3 resident, educated in Blount County Schools 4.

Career

Jones has worked in public service throughout his career: five and a half years at Citizens Bank of Blount County, and currently at the Knox County Register of Deeds, where he handles public funds and records. He began as an intern with Blount County government and says he has attended county commission meetings since 2018. He is a certified county government administrator through the University of Tennessee, and serves with Good Neighbors of Blount County and the Blount County Historical Museum 4.
